Fiber Laser Cutting Machine
If you’re looking for a laser cutting machine that’s perfect for cutting metal letters, the fiber laser cutting machine is the one you need!
When it comes to cutting metal, fiber laser cutting offers several advantages over traditional cutting methods like plasma cutting. One of the main advantages is its precision. The fiber laser cutting machine can create intricate and detailed cuts with minimal heat affected zones, resulting in clean and smooth edges.
Additionally, fiber laser cutting is faster and more efficient than plasma cutting, allowing for higher production rates. Another advantage is its versatility. The fiber laser cutting machine can handle a wide range of metals, including stainless steel, aluminum, and brass.
With all these benefits, the fiber laser cutting machine is a top choice for metal fabrication.

Can laser cutting machines cut materials other than metal?
Laser cutting machines are versatile tools that can cut materials other than metal, offering several advantages. They provide high precision and intricate designs, making them ideal for non-metal materials like wood, acrylic, and fabric. With their focused laser beams, they can easily achieve intricate cuts and create complex shapes.
However, laser cutting machines have limitations when it comes to thicker and harder materials like stone and glass, as they may require alternative cutting methods.
How does the cost of a fiber laser cutting machine compare to a CO2 laser cutting machine?
When comparing the cost of a fiber laser cutting machine to a CO2 laser cutting machine, there are several factors to consider.
A fiber laser cutting machine offers numerous advantages, such as higher cutting speeds and lower maintenance costs. Additionally, fiber lasers are more energy-efficient and have a longer lifespan. However, they tend to be more expensive upfront compared to CO2 lasers.
Ultimately, the decision should be based on your specific needs and budget.
